09:42 — The Merrowvale Clinic reminder job (RemindlyBatch) began its nightly run but selected the wrong timezone offset for patients in the western region, shifting all appointment reminders forward by one day. The scheduler logged no errors because the offset fell within validation bounds. On-call paused the queue at 09:58 before SMS dispatch started, so no incorrect messages left the system. The faulty run is fully reproducible; the build responsible is identified by the token below.

build token for hafop-fawif: htk31_9758d5e565aa3b14f55d629377373c4

# Runbook: Hunting leaked file descriptors in Quillgate

When the `fd_open` gauge climbs steadily between deploys, suspect a leak rather than load. First confirm on a single pod: exec in and count entries under `/proc/1/fd`, noting how many are sockets in CLOSE_WAIT versus regular files. Capture two snapshots ten minutes apart before restarting anything — we need the delta for the postmortem. Reproduce locally with the Marbury load harness, which requires the service running with the following configuration values.

settings of yagep-bajog:
[istdor]
port = 4000
region = south-2
host = istdor.qorvelcorp.internal
timeout_ms = 5000
retries = 5

Ticket: Glyphbox invoice renderer failing in CI. Root cause: the service credential for the Inkmoor asset store expired Tuesday, so font and logo fetches 401 and renders fall back to placeholder glyphs. Affects all PDF golden-file tests; please don't approve renderer PRs until green. Fix: credential reissued, CI secret updated, pipeline re-run queued. For local reproduction of the failing suite, point your Inkmoor client at staging and use the replacement key below.

app token of badug-tahaf = qvz11-nP5FBNr8qnh